Get a master cylinder with a smaller bore, 1.00...

Get a master cylinder with a smaller bore, 1.00 dia. is too big.
There is a aluminum small bore cylinder (metric about .75) on
1986 mustangs. Or a tilton .625 - .75 dia.

The 1965 & 66 calipers use a .375 X 24 hose...

The 1965 & 66 calipers use a .375 X 24 hose fitting, the 1967 use a 7/16 X 24 brake hose fitting. I had Wilwood 4 piston ( 1.75 dia. ) pistons on the front of my 1965 mustang and could never get it...
